SB 974 Pennsylvania Senate · 2025-2026 Regular Session

An Act amending the act of March 10, 1949 (P.L.30, No.14), known as the Public School Code of 1949, in miscellaneous provisions relating to institutions of higher education, further providing for Dual Credit Innovation Grant Program.

SB 974 establishes a grant program within Pennsylvania's Department of Education to fund public colleges and community education councils that offer dual credit courses to high school students. The program prioritizes institutions expanding access for underserved groups, including rural students, low-income students, career and technical education participants, and those experiencing education instability. Grants require recipients to report annual data on students earning college credits through these partnerships and their post-graduation college enrollment, with this information made publicly available online. The bill directly affects public higher education institutions, community education councils, and high school students participating in dual credit programs.
